LEWIS COUNTY- Roof and water damage have been reported in the wake of a chimney fire over the weekend in Copenhagen, NY.
It happened Sunday afternoon at an apartment building on Maple Avenue, according to the latest from WWNY-TV. Firefighters told reporters on scene that the fire may have sparked due to overheating.
It’s reported that all tenants inside managed to escape unharmed. Firefighters managed to attack and douse the flames quickly.
Officials say the chimney will need replacement. Roof and water damage was reported. During the replacement process, officials say tenants will be able to remain.
This is the first time a fire has sparked within Copenhagen’s village limits since Rutland took over its coverage.
